The Diagnosis If you are encountering "Failed to load DLL Error 4," the issue is almost certainly a missing dependency rather than a corrupt game file. TeknoParrot acts as a loader for arcade games, and it relies on specific Windows multimedia libraries to function. Error 4 specifically indicates that the system cannot locate or load the XAudio sound library.
The 5-Minute Fix Summary:
Unlike a simple crash, Error 4 is a low-level Windows loader error. It signals that the operating system attempted—and failed—to map a required dynamic link library into TeknoParrot’s process memory. The error code 4 corresponds to ERROR_FILE_NOT_FOUND (or sometimes ERROR_PATH_NOT_FOUND in extended contexts), but the message is deceptive: the missing DLL might not be the one named in the error. It could be a dependency of that DLL, a missing Visual C++ runtime, or even a corrupted system file. teknoparrot failed to load dll error 4 install
TeknoParrot.exe → Properties → Compatibility.Then reboot. This fixes missing COM registration or corrupted kernel32.dll exports. The Fix: Resolving TeknoParrot "Failed to load DLL
TeknoParrot folder on your hard drive.support or redist.ParrotLoaderDriver.exe or InstallDriver.exe.If you are using a laptop with two graphics cards, the emulator may fail to load the DLL because it's trying to use the integrated chip. Open the NVIDIA Control Panel or AMD Software. Go to Program Settings and add TeknoParrotUi.exe. The 5-Minute Fix Summary: Unlike a simple crash,